Takamatsu - Kinashi - Kagawa Prefecture - http://bonsai.shikoku-np.co.jp/
Kagawa Prefecture is the smallest prefecture in Japan in terms of territory. Yet it is Japan's largest producer of matsu (pine) bonsai trees. Up-to-date information comes from Takamatsu, the capital of Kagawa Prefecture, which continues to maintain the world's No. 1 bonsai culture with its long history of bonsai cultivation.
